Christians are only Jesus' servants. So, we call Jesus Lord. In Romans 1:1, Paul, a servant of Jesus Christ, called to be an apostle, separated unto the gospel of God Not only the apostle Paul, the saints are all servants of Christ in the Lord. In 1 Corinthians 7:22, For he that is called in the Lord, being a servant, is the Lord's freeman: likewise also he that is called, being free, is Christ's servant. Even though the saint is a servant of Jesus, he is a free man who cannot be bound by anyone. Because God bought it for the blood of Jesus. In 1 Corinthians 7:23 Ye are bought with a price; be not ye the servants of men. He said in Galatians 5:1. Stand fast therefore in the liberty wherewith Christ hath made us free, and be not entangled again with the yoke of bondage.
